The Design Coordinator role



As Design Coordinator you will be responsible for coordinating the design process on a £10 Million Design & Build project. Reporting to the Regional Design Manager the role will be responsible for coordinating the design process including buildability and value engineering; working with clients, architects and consultants; attending and chairing design meetings with relevant stakeholders; coordinate, manage and disseminate all relevant drawings and paperwork; ensuring the design process is managed throughout and the building is successfully delivered in line with all specifications.

Required experience



Successful applicants will have a proven track record of undertaking the role of Design Coordinator for a main contractor who undertake projects of a similar size and nature. In addition successful applicants should either be from a trade, engineering or site management background or hold an HNC or degree level qualification in a construction discipline.
